Food & drink in Norfolk
Norfolk’s food and drink scene is shaped by what’s grown and reared nearby, with plenty of menus built around seasonal produce and local suppliers. From relaxed pubs and coastal spots to cafés, bakeries and restaurants that make a meal feel like the main event, you’ll find a strong mix of everyday favourites and something a bit special.
Norfolk’s market towns and Norwich add even more choice, with independent places to eat and drink, local ales and spirits and plenty of opportunities to try regional produce along the way.
